Community Tasting Notes (53) Avg Score: 91.6 points

  • This bottle followed closely the TN of our previous bottle some nine months ago -- and was even more enjoyable -- leading me to believe that this wine is not past its prime and may continue to drink well for several more years.
    After a 40 minute decant this medium plus bodied wine showed lots of dark fruit and spice, some earth, balancing acidity and a touch of tannin on the finish. Air it out and enjoy at will.

  • I have been drinking a few cases of this incrementally over the years and will consume the rest of my stash in the next 3-5 years. Still very strong. Gaining complexity and spice - especially black pepper on the finish, which is gaining length. Less vanilla than previously, but fruit is more integrated, and tertiary flavors are making this more interesting with time.

    Notes are after a 2.5 hour decant. Well stored bottles still have plenty of life.

  • Decanted for 30 minutes but continued to open for 30 minutes more. The color was a deep dark ruby to a lighter rim. Dark fruits and baking spices on the nose. The medium plus bodied palate showed lots of dark fruits (black cherry, blackberry, blackcurrant), baking spices (esp. cinnamon), and only touches of minerality, oak and tannin. The acidity was juicy and balancing. Not sure I agree that this wine is past its prime - as others have said - but I would suggest opening, decanting and enjoying it in the next year or two for maximum enjoyment.
